**Q: How do I adjust search relevance weights in Quillfern?**

Relevance tuning lives in the Quillfern ranking console under Signals. Support agents can preview weight changes against the shadow index but cannot publish them; publishing requires the relevance admin role. If a customer reports stale rankings, check that the synonym pack finished compiling before escalating. To unlock the tuning console after three failed sign-ins, the on-shift lead enters the recovery passphrase. For reference, the current passphrase is:

strongbox words: wenix-ulador

The Orvane Labs bike cage and the east and west parking gates operate on separate access schedules, and facilities desk staff should note that visitor vehicles may only use the west gate between 07:00 and 19:00. Cyclists requesting cage access must show a valid day pass, and their details should be entered in the access ledger before the cage is opened. Gates must never be propped open, even briefly, during deliveries. When a manual override is required at either gate, use the code below.

staff pass of fadup-fawig = bdg-FUNKS-4

## Service account: dedupe-runner

The `dedupe-runner` account merges duplicate customer records in the Corvane directory nightly. It has write access to `customers` only; merges are logged to `dedupe_audit`. Never run it against production manually without a dry-run first. It authenticates to the internal Matchbridge service with the key below.

service key, fawip-bajef: kto11_Qt5wZK9vdNC

Leadership Review Briefing — Licensing Dispute

Varnholt Systems has formally contested our continued use of the Quellis rendering module in the Atraval product line, claiming the 2021 licence lapsed on renewal. Counsel at Merrow & Stane advises our position is defensible but litigation costs could be significant. Options under evaluation: negotiated settlement, licence repurchase, or migration to the in-house Corvane engine. Department heads should flag dependencies on Quellis by Friday. The recommended path forward is set out below.

board note of fahap-yafop: Headcount on the Istion team goes from 50 to 73 by the end of September. Gross margin on Istion came in at 33 percent against a plan of 28 percent.